About the technology

Core use

SAP FI is the financial accounting part of SAP ERP and SAP S/4HANA. It supports the records companies rely on for day-to-day finance, reporting, and audit trails. Common work includes ledgers, posting logic, and clean integration with related finance processes.

Typical deliverables

  • General ledger setup and account structures
  • Accounts payable and receivable flows
  • Asset accounting and tax-relevant postings
  • Month-end and year-end closing support
  • Error analysis for posting and reconciliation issues

Ecosystem

Strong SAP FI work rarely stands alone. It connects with SAP CO, MM, SD, and Treasury, plus banking interfaces, payment runs, and reporting tools. In many projects, specialists also work with FI/CO topics, user roles, and authorization concepts.

What strong specialists do

Good experts understand business processes, not only configuration screens. They can translate finance requirements into posting logic, document types, validation rules, and account determination. They also know how to document changes clearly so finance teams and auditors can follow them.

SAP FI is used for financial accounting in SAP landscapes. It covers the core postings and controls that feed the general ledger, supplier and customer balances, asset accounting, and financial closing. Companies use it to keep accounting data structured, traceable, and ready for reporting.

SAP FI records external financial accounting, while SAP CO focuses on internal controlling and cost analysis. They are closely linked, which is why many projects speak about FI/CO together. If your issue is statutory accounting, postings, or closing, FI is the right area.

No. SAP FI is the financial accounting part, while SAP FICO usually refers to the combined FI and CO area. Many professionals work across both, but if your need is strictly financial accounting, a focused FI specialist is often the better fit.
